How Life Works Here
Victoria Pathway is located in Cheshire West and Chester, near Chester. Crime is around average for the area, with 81 incidents in the past year. The most commonly reported category is violence and sexual offences. Violent offences account for 62% of reported crimes. Some amenities are available nearby, though a car may be useful for regular errands like grocery shopping. Public transport is accessible, with rail and bus stops within reach. The nearest is about 141m away. The median property price is £562,500, with exceptional growth of 54% over five years. Based on 12 transactions recorded since 2014. Rented accommodation predominates. There are 5 schools within 2 km, 5 rated Good or Outstanding by Ofsted. Both primary and secondary options are available locally. The nearest school is just 218m away. This street may particularly suit property investors. Market indicators suggest an upward trend. Overall, this street scores 51 out of 100 for liveability.
